Compatibility
X-keys USB devices require MacroWorks 3 for Windows XP, Vista, or 7 or
ControllerMate for Mac OS X. The X-keys Stick also has a “Hardware Mode”
which gives it the ability to mimic a USB keyboard or mouse on any USB
enabled operating system (including Linux). Learn more about Hardware Mode
on our web site or contact our Technical Support Department
(tech@xkeys.com).
Identifying the Keys
Select legends from the pre-printed sheet or use the blank legend sheet to
create your own key legends. The keycap lenses snap off with a fingernail or
small screwdriver. Place the legend inside the lens, and replace it. The key
caps hold a legend 0.575" wide and 0.5" high (14.6mm x 12.7mm). Other
